Gold marginally less; Silver Broken ₹ 515

According to HDFC Securities, gold prices declined marginally by Rs 6 to Rs 46,123 per 10 grams in the national capital on Wednesday.

The precious metal had closed at ₹ 46,129 per 10 grams in the previous trade.

Silver fell by ₹ 515 to ₹ 61,821 per kg from ₹ 62,336 per kg in the previous trade.

In the international market, gold was trading flat at $ 1,811 an ounce and silver at $ 23.82 an ounce.

According to HDFC Securities, Senior Analyst (Commodities), “Gold prices traded weak with spot gold prices at $1,811 an ounce in COMEX trading on Wednesday. Gold prices on a stronger dollar and positive equity indices traded lower in recent highs. level business.” Tapan Patel.
